Some people in the US make just $6 an hour, while others earn a whopping $106 during that same 60-minute period.
Advertisement
The federal minimum wage is $7.25 an hour. In some states, however, employees not covered under the Fair Labor Standards Act earn as little as $5.15.
According to the US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), the average American - including those in salaried jobs - earns $23.23 an hour, and that number reaches more than $100 for some professions.
